Boys of steel : the creators of Superman / by Nobleman, Marc Tyler.(CARDINAL)644351; MacDonald, Ross,1957-(CARDINAL)345312; MacDonald, Ross,1957-illustrator.(CARDINAL)345312;
Includes bibliographical references.Jerry Siegel & Joe Shuster, two misfit teens in Cleveland, were more like Clark Kent than Superman. Both boys escaped into the worlds of science fiction and pulp magazine tales. In 1934, they created the superhero, but it was four years before they convinced a publisher to take a chance on their Man of Steel in a new format--the comic book.760LAccelerated Reader ARA Junior Library Guild selection

High bias : the distorted history of the cassette tape / by Masters, Marc,author.(CARDINAL)879336;
Includes bibliographical references and index."Marc Masters explores the surprising ups and downs of the cassette tape's journey through international music culture, showing us the cultural impact of cassettes on music listening, music portability, and music making itself. Winding through early hip-hop tape trading, the deeply personal act of making a mixtape, and even contemporary composers who use cassettes to create musique concrète compositions, this book chronicles the resilient do-it-yourself spirit of cassettes through conversations with scene-setters coupled with deep explorations into music history. More than just the most comprehensive history of how cassettes have changed music, this is also a vivid tribute to a format that refuses to fade away"--
